What Are the Key Factors That Make a Backpack Brand Stand Out?

The key factors that make a backpack brand stand out include quality, design, functionality, brand reputation, and customer service.

  • Quality: A standout backpack brand typically uses high-quality materials and construction techniques that ensure durability and longevity. Brands that focus on quality often include features such as reinforced stitching, water-resistant fabrics, and robust zippers, which enhance the backpack’s ability to withstand various conditions and heavy use.
  • Design: Innovative and appealing design plays a crucial role in a backpack brand’s popularity. Brands that offer unique aesthetics, vibrant colors, and practical layouts that cater to different user preferences often attract a loyal customer base, as they combine style with utility.
  • Functionality: The best backpack brands excel in providing functional features tailored to specific activities, such as hiking, travel, or school. This includes adjustable compartments, hydration systems, or tech-friendly pockets, ensuring users find the backpack suitable for their needs and enhancing their overall experience.
  • Brand Reputation: A strong brand reputation built on consistent performance and positive customer feedback can significantly influence a brand’s standing in the market. Brands that are known for their commitment to sustainability, innovation, and customer satisfaction tend to attract more attention and loyalty from consumers.
  • Customer Service: Excellent customer service can set a backpack brand apart, as it reflects the company’s dedication to its customers. Brands that offer generous warranties, easy returns, and responsive support create an overall positive buying experience, encouraging repeat business and brand advocacy.

Which Brands Are the Best for Hiking Backpacks?

The best brands for hiking backpacks are known for their durability, comfort, and functionality.

  • Osprey: Osprey is renowned for its innovative designs and ergonomic features. Their backpacks often include adjustable harnesses and hip belts, allowing for a customized fit that enhances comfort on long hikes.
  • Deuter: Deuter backpacks are celebrated for their durability and robust construction. They utilize high-quality materials and offer a variety of models that cater to different hiking styles, ensuring both comfort and practicality.
  • Gregory: Gregory packs are designed with the hiker’s anatomy in mind, providing excellent load distribution. Their attention to detail in fit and features like ventilation and accessibility make them a favorite among serious trekkers.
  • The North Face: The North Face combines style with functionality, offering a wide range of backpacks suitable for various outdoor activities. Their products are often equipped with innovative materials and technologies that enhance weather resistance and durability.
  • REI Co-op: REI Co-op offers quality backpacks at a more accessible price point, making them a great option for both beginners and experienced hikers. Their packs are designed with a focus on utility and comfort, often featuring ample storage and organization options.
  • Arc’teryx: Known for their premium quality, Arc’teryx backpacks are built for serious outdoor enthusiasts. They emphasize lightweight designs and high-performance materials, making them ideal for demanding conditions and rugged terrains.
  • Mountain Hardwear: Mountain Hardwear backpacks are engineered for functionality in extreme conditions. Their packs often incorporate features like hydration reservoirs and multiple access points, making them versatile for various hiking scenarios.
  • Columbia: Columbia offers a range of outdoor gear, including hiking backpacks that balance price and performance. Their packs often include comfort features like padded straps and breathable materials, catering to casual hikers and weekend adventurers.

What Brands Lead the Market for Eco-Friendly Backpacks?

The brands leading the market for eco-friendly backpacks combine sustainability with style and functionality.

  • Patagonia: Known for its commitment to environmental responsibility, Patagonia uses recycled materials and ethical labor practices in its production. Their backpacks are designed for durability and versatility, making them suitable for outdoor adventures while supporting eco-friendly initiatives.
  • North Face: The North Face incorporates sustainable materials such as recycled polyester and organic cotton in their backpack designs. They also promote a circular economy by encouraging customers to recycle their old gear through their Clothes the Loop program.
  • Osprey: Osprey focuses on creating long-lasting packs that reduce waste and emphasizes repairability. They have a dedicated recycling program called Osprey ReCycle, where customers can return their old packs to be repurposed or recycled.
  • Fjällräven: Fjällräven is committed to sustainable practices, using materials like G-1000, which can be waxed for waterproofing and durability. Their products are designed for longevity, and they prioritize animal welfare by using ethically sourced down and leather.
  • Terra Thread: This brand features backpacks made from organic cotton and recycled materials, focusing on fair labor practices. Terra Thread also commits to planting a tree for every backpack sold, reinforcing their dedication to environmental impact.
  • Everlane: Everlane offers a range of backpacks made with recycled materials and transparent pricing models. Their ethical approach to manufacturing ensures that customers know the true cost of production and the impact on the environment.
  • REI Co-op: REI Co-op supports sustainability through its own brand of backpacks crafted from recycled materials. They also promote responsible outdoor practices and contribute to various environmental initiatives, reinforcing their commitment to protecting nature.
